Battery life is typically shorter when using heavier applications like movies and games. Lowering the brightness on the screen can prolong the life of the battery. It is unlikely that you will prefer the brightest setting and the improvement will be worth it.
You can bring up a list of every app currently running on your iPad. Press the Home button twice and a bar with the running apps will appear. It is easy to switch to an app by tapping it on the bar. Swipe downward on the screen to make the bar disappear.

You will be using VPN networks if you are trying to get in contact with remote servers. You can connect to VPN connections using the iPad by navigating to Network, which is located under Settings, and turning on VPN. Enter the required username and server address. If you don’t have the server address, contact the network administrator.
If you are sick and tired of being notified of a local Wi-Fi connection, change your settings. You’ll see the option about Joining Networks. Turn that setting off, and you will finally be rid of the constant notifications.
Change the settings in your inbox so you’re able to see more than a couple of lines in an email. Under Settings, navigate to Mail, and look for the Preview setting. If you select five lines, you will be able to get a good idea of what your emails are about before you open them. This will allow you to see more of your message for quicker skimming.

If you don’t have a lot of time, avoid using your iPhone charger in order to charge your iPad. This is because iPads have higher wattage requirements than iPhones. Charging with an iPhone charger will take far more time. Use the proper iPad charger.
